Output 884c1faf1d66e7c06ac677f6b8df79128476ea43f2e646c6dc764453c047bb59: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d600eb4061bf248c0721652a19a6a5bc5efacaef OP_EQUAL
address
3MCZdSnGcHshPpTNiEV7pD9phk8raEZQPW
transaction
884c1faf1d66e7c06ac677f6b8df79128476ea43f2e646c6dc764453c047bb59
spent
true